[SET]
name: Physically Defensive
move 1: Foul Play
move 2: U-turn / Toxic
move 3: Toxic / Defog / Knock Off
move 4: Roost
item: Heavy-Duty Boots
ability: Unaware / Well-Baked Body / Fluffy
nature: Relaxed
evs: 248 HP / 252 Def / 8 SpD
ivs: 0 Spe

[SET COMMENTS]
Mandibuzz is an excellent physical wall, leveraging its typing, excellent role compression, and good natural bulk to act as a valuable teammate, checking threats like Psychic Surge Deoxys-S, Azelf, and Choice Band Roaring Moon. U-turn, in combination with 0 Speed IVs and a Relaxed nature, allows Mandibuzz to act as a fantastic slow pivot, benefiting frail wallbreakers like Chien-Pao, Galarian Zapdos, and Walking Wake, while Toxic allows it to cripple switch-ins like Great Tusk and Zapdos. Defog allows Mandibuzz to act as an excellent hazard control option that is appreciated by wallbreakers and pivots like Chien-Pao, Roaring Moon, and Azelf, while Knock Off can cripple other switch-ins like Corviknight, Magic Guard Quaquaval, and Galarian Zapdos. Unaware allows Mandibuzz to better check setup threats like Bulk Up Great Tusk, Dragon Dance Dragonite, and Swords Dance Ceruledge, while Well-Baked Body allows it to check Cinderace and Ogerpon-H while still checking the aforementioned Swords Dance Ceruledge, and Fluffy allows it to have an easier time checking wallbreakers like Choice Band Roaring Moon, Barraskewda, and Galarian Zapdos. Mandibuzz has a poor matchup against certain wallbreakers like Chien-Pao and Iron Boulder; thus, a secondary physical wall like Intimidate Corviknight is appreciated. Mandibuzz also appreciates special walls like RegenVest Hisuian Goodra, Manaphy, and Swampert that can switch into specially offensive threats like Walking Wake, Iron Moth, and Sandy Shocks.
